Output 770a5226d9301d96fbdfc886b8348d5a9e3aa15fd9d10e735ec81cffca20b4b9:0

value
38074950
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c09959839329d136545b996e2829890e04d2a35f OP_EQUAL
address
MRTXgBa74RARzajZoE3sjoaU4myJYPwi4N
transaction
770a5226d9301d96fbdfc886b8348d5a9e3aa15fd9d10e735ec81cffca20b4b9
spent
true